Summary:
In 1684 France, Louis XIV, the Sun King, is the most powerful and influential monarch on the planet. But his birthday is approaching along with a rare solar eclipse and he's worried about the future of France. His spiritual advisor, Pè€re La Chaise, comforts him, while his physician, Dr. Labarthe informs him that scientists believe mermaids contain a life force that grants immortality. Louis XIV's quest for immortality leads him to capture a mermaid's life force, but his immovable will is challenged when his long-hidden illegitimate daughter forms a bond with the magical creature.
